MySQL5.7.28 詳細的部署安裝流程


1、創建mysql安裝文件目錄
mkdir -p /opt/mysql
cd /opt/mysql
從dev.mysql.com下載mysql二進制文件
2、解壓
tar zxvf  mysql-5.7.28-el7-x86_64.tar.gz

3、創建軟連接
cd /usr/local
ln -s /opt/mysql/mysql-5.7.28-el7-x86_64 /usr/local/mysql

4、新增mysql用戶和組
userdel mysql
groupadd mysql
useradd -M -g mysql -s /sbin/nologin -d /usr/local/mysql mysql

5、更改profile文件
cat >> /etc/profile
PATH=$PATH:/usr/local/mysql/bin
source /etc/profile

6、檢查是否生效
mysql --help

7、創建mysql數據及日志目錄
mkdir -p /data/mysql/{mysql3306,mysql3307,mysql3308,mysql3309,mysql3310,mysql3311}/{tmp,data,logs}
chown -R mysql:mysql /data/mysql
chmod 705 /data

8、初始化
mysqld --defaults-file=/data/mysql/mysql3306/my3306.cnf --initialize
--cnf文件請參照官方文檔進行配置

9、啟動
mysqld --defaults-file=/data/mysql/mysql3306/my3306.cnf &

10、檢查是否正常運行
netstat -lnt|grep 3306
ps -ef|grep mysql

11、登錄
mysql -uroot -p -S /tmp/mysql3306.sock
--初始登錄密碼請在數據文件目錄/data/mysql/mysql3306/data/error.log

12、修改密碼
alter user user() identified by 'redhat';


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M